I know winter is winding down and so the need for firewood is going away for a bit. I'm getting a lot of crooked branches from logging, and I'm having a hard time placing them for 'useful bloat'.
This could be an issue with the campfire capacity, or with the branches themselves, or with my methodology. Felling a large tree generates hundreds of branches, which fall into LARGE, MEDIUM, or SMALL. There is no fatwood variety of crooked branch. Because the burntime on branches is low, I'm spending a lot of time tending the fire. This is realistic, but a bit fiddly.

Fuel Time: A full campfire lasts about 1 hour and a half.
Large branches (of which 15 can be put into a campfire) 5 minute
Medium branches (of which 33 can be put into a campfire) 2 minute
small branch (of which about 66 can be put into a campfire) 1 minute

It's a bit fiddly to need to go through SPLIT X branch put branch in campfire every few minutes to feed a campfire. If there was a way to automatically feed crooked branches into a campfire, that would be appreciated.
Another suggestion below.
As there is little use for crooked branches outside of creating campfire bundles and campfire teepees, it would be nice if branches could be added in larger quantities to campfires, or if we had a larger campfire option we could build to light more branches at once. This helps generate more charcoal, or reduces the amount of fiddling with individual branch quantities.
